In recent years, quality assurance teams have become accustomed to a variety of new technologies. It has been a big change for the many quality assurance analysts who came of age at a time when waterfall development methodologies and PC-centric applications were their front and center concerns.

Now they have to adjust to the realities of cloud computing and the ever-expanding mobile device ecosystem. A lot of infrastructures, development platforms and applications are being shifted off-premises to public and private clouds, while the device mix at many enterprises is becoming more diverse.
